Back to all posts
AI customer support

AI Customer Support for Ecommerce: How to Set It Up Right

A practical guide to AI customer support for ecommerce: which questions to automate, where order data and human handoff matter, and how to set it up without breaking trust.

11 min read
Ecommerce AI customer support Support automation Human handoff WISMO
Editorial illustration of an online store on a phone and laptop, with a chat widget answering 'Where is my order?' beside an order-tracking timeline (Ordered, Shipped, Out for delivery) and a 'Talk to a human' button.

Most ecommerce support volume is not interesting, and that is exactly why AI helps. A large share of your tickets are the same handful of questions — where is my order, what is your return policy, does this come in my size — repeated thousands of times across email, chat, and DMs.

This guide is about putting an AI agent in front of that volume without making your store feel worse. I will be specific about what AI can answer well on a storefront, what still needs a real action on order data, and where a human has to take over. Owlish is our product, so I will show where it fits — and where a Shopify-native helpdesk is the better buy.

Ecommerce support is different from generic support

A SaaS support queue is mostly “how do I use this feature.” An ecommerce queue is mostly logistics and money: orders, shipping, returns, refunds, and “did my payment go through.”

Three things make it harder than it looks:

The takeaway: ecommerce support is unusually repetitive and unusually time-sensitive. That is the ideal shape for AI to take the first pass — as long as you draw the lines correctly.

Step 1: Map your contact reasons before you automate anything

Do not start by “turning on AI.” Start by pulling your last few hundred conversations and sorting them into three buckets: questions AI can answer from documented content, questions that need live order data or a write action, and questions that need a human.

That sort decides everything else. Here is a typical ecommerce breakdown.

Contact reasonWho should handle itWhy
Return / shipping / warranty policyAI, grounded in your policy pagesThe answer is documented and stable
Product, sizing, compatibilityAI, grounded in product contentDocumented; escalate if the agent is unsure
”Where is my order?”AI if it can read order/tracking data; otherwise route to self-serviceHigh volume, but lookup-driven
Process a refund, edit or cancel an orderHuman, or a store-connected actionNeeds a write action on real order data
Damaged item, wrong item, complaintsHuman handoffNeeds judgment and goodwill
Pre-sale “will this work for me?”AI, escalate when it mattersConversion-sensitive; wrong answers cost sales

The pattern: AI is strongest where the answer already exists in your content, and weakest where it needs to act on a specific order. Keep those separate and the rest of the setup gets simple.

Step 2: Ground the agent in your real store content

The questions in the top two rows above — policies, products, sizing — are where an AI agent earns its keep on day one. But only if it answers from your content, not from a general model guess about how returns “usually” work.

That is the difference between a grounded agent and a generic chatbot. A grounded agent retrieves the relevant passage from your store’s own material before it answers, and ideally shows where the answer came from so an operator can verify it. We have written separately about why grounded answers matter and how to build a knowledge base that survives real questions.

For a store, the sources worth ingesting first are:

Owlish ingests websites, PDFs, DOCX, CSV, TXT, Markdown, and direct FAQ pairs, and can show source citations in the web widget so your team can confirm what an answer was based on. See the knowledge base overview and web widget docs.

One practical rule: write the policy answer the way a customer asks it, not the way Legal wrote it. “Can I return a sale item?” should retrieve cleanly, which it will not if the only source is a 12-page terms document with the answer buried in clause 7.

Step 3: Be honest about order data

Here is where ecommerce AI gets oversold. “Where is my order?” looks like a perfect automation target — it is high volume and the answer is factual. But the answer lives in your order and shipping systems, not in your help content. To answer it directly, the agent needs to read live order data; to process a refund or edit an order, it needs to write to it.

You have three honest options:

  1. Deflect with self-service. Point WISMO questions at your order-tracking page or a “track my order” flow, and let the AI answer the surrounding policy questions (“how long does shipping take,” “what does ‘processing’ mean”). This works on any stack and cuts a surprising amount of volume on its own.
  2. Connect order data through an ecommerce-native helpdesk. Tools like Gorgias are built around Shopify and other store platforms, with native integration that lets the agent pull up an order and take in-conversation actions. Gorgias positions itself as the conversational AI platform for ecommerce and reports its AI Agent resolving roughly 60% of routine inquiries (Gorgias). If your support is dominated by order edits, refunds, and cancellations, that depth is the point.
  3. Pair a grounded agent with human handoff for the rest. Let AI own the documented questions and hand the order-action and judgment cases to an operator with the full thread attached.

Owlish today is built for the first and third options. It grounds answers on your store content and hands off cleanly to a human, but it does not natively pull live Shopify order status or process refunds and edits — native store order actions are on our roadmap, not shipped. If “edit this order inside the chat” is your core requirement, an ecommerce-native helpdesk is the more honest choice, and I would rather say that than pretend otherwise.

Step 4: Set the escalation rules before launch, not after

The fastest way to lose trust is an AI that confidently answers a refund-status question it has no way to verify. Decide your handoff triggers up front:

When the agent escalates, the customer should not have to repeat themselves and the operator should get the full conversation. We cover the mechanics in AI support handoff: when bots should escalate.

In Owlish, human handoff and the shared helpdesk inbox start on the Growth plan, so the AI-to-human path is one workflow rather than a bolt-on. See the human handoff docs.

Step 5: Meet customers where they message

Ecommerce conversations do not only happen on your site. A growing share start on WhatsApp, Messenger, and Instagram, especially outside the US.

Decide which channels actually matter for your store before you buy for all of them. For most stores the web widget is the anchor, with messaging channels added as real demand shows up. Owlish runs the web widget on every plan, adds Slack, Microsoft Teams, and Google Chat on Growth, and adds WhatsApp, Messenger, and Telegram on Scale (pricing). We have a step-by-step for the most common starting point: how to add an AI chatbot to your website.

Step 6: Reduce the questions before they become tickets

The best ecommerce support improvement is often not a faster answer — it is a question that never gets asked. WISMO is the clearest example: proactive shipping updates and clear delivery estimates at checkout are repeatedly shown to cut “where is my order” contacts substantially.

So pair your AI agent with the boring fundamentals:

AI handles the questions that remain; good operations shrink how many there are.

Where Owlish fits for an ecommerce store

Choose Owlish when your priority is a grounded front line and a clean handoff:

Choose an ecommerce-native helpdesk instead when in-conversation order management is the core job — when “look up this order and refund it” needs to happen inside the chat across Shopify or another platform. That is a different product category, and a store drowning in order edits should buy for it directly.

Public Owlish pricing starts at $49/mo monthly or $39/mo billed annually for Starter, $149/mo monthly or $119/mo billed annually for Growth (where human handoff and the shared inbox begin), and $449/mo monthly or $359/mo billed annually for Scale (which adds WhatsApp, Messenger, and Telegram). See the pricing page for the full breakdown.

What to measure after launch

Do not judge an ecommerce support agent on a single resolution-rate number. Track:

Broader industry data shows autonomous AI handling a large share of routine service contacts and improving resolution times, but your own numbers on the four points above are what tell you it is working (Zendesk AI customer service statistics). We go deeper in AI customer service metrics: what to measure after launch.

FAQ

Can AI handle “where is my order?” questions for an ecommerce store?

Partly. AI can answer the policy side (“how long does shipping take,” “what does processing mean”) from your content immediately. To answer the specific order (“where is order #1234”), the agent needs to read live order data, which usually means an ecommerce-native helpdesk integration or routing the customer to a self-service tracking flow. Owlish grounds the policy answers and hands off the rest; it does not natively read live Shopify order status today.

Is a Shopify-native helpdesk better than a general AI support tool?

It depends on your queue. If most of your volume is order edits, refunds, and cancellations, a Shopify-native helpdesk like Gorgias is built for in-conversation order actions and is likely the better fit (Gorgias). If most of your volume is policy, product, and pre-sale questions, a grounded agent with clean handoff covers it at lower complexity.

How much can AI realistically deflect for a store?

Treat vendor headline numbers as ceilings, not promises. Resolution depends on how documented your policies are and how much of your volume needs an order action. The reliable win is the repetitive, documented questions; budget for human handoff on the rest rather than expecting a single number to hold across every store.

Will an AI agent hurt customer trust?

Only if it guesses. A grounded agent that answers from your real content, shows its sources, and escalates when it is unsure tends to raise trust, because customers get fast, accurate answers and a clean path to a human when they need one. The risk is a generic bot that improvises policy it cannot verify.

Sources

Comparison context was gathered from public vendor pages in May 2026 and may change; check the linked pages for current details.

Trademark note

Gorgias, Shopify, Intercom, Zendesk, and other product names mentioned here are trademarks or registered trademarks of their respective owners. Owlish is not affiliated with or endorsed by those companies unless explicitly stated.

Where to start with Owlish

If your store’s volume is mostly policy, product, and pre-sale questions, start by pointing an agent at your shipping and return pages, your product content, and your FAQ, then add human handoff for the order-action cases. The pricing page shows where each capability begins, and building your first agent walks through the setup. You will know quickly whether the agent behaves like part of your store or just another bot.

Keep reading

Related posts

Try Owlish

Build a support agent your operators actually trust.

Start Free without a card. Source-cited answers. Hand off to a human the moment the agent isn't sure.